dc.description.abstractThe current flowing in current conducting materials induces the electromagnetic forces. The paper describes the finite element analysis of a linear electromagnetic launcher. The demonstrated distribution of the volume forces presents the results obtained in studying the distribution of forces along the rail during launching. The calculations made with operating of a fixed projectile position shows that the force is distributed non-uniformly along the rail in the case of the rail-armature operation. The simulation results are compared to the solutions obtained using a simplified engineering approach. The main differences in distribution of forces in the rail in the contacting zone between the rail and the armature are discussedeng
